About This Airport

Arkansas International Airport (KBYH/BYH) is an airport available for virtual and real-world pilots. It is located near Blytheville, US. The airport has 1 runway. The longest is runway 18/36 measuring 11,602 feet, with a Unknown surface. This airport can accommodate heavy aircraft such as the Boeing 747 or Airbus A380. Runways are equipped with lighting for night operations. The airport has 2 radio frequencies for ATC communications.
